Abstract

The present invention relates to a new inert matrix having adjustable porosity and hardness. This matrix comprises polycaprolactone having an average molecular weight of between 2000 and 70,000, which is in the form of agglomerated grains having an average diameter of between 50 and 500 .mu.m and has a degree of crystallinity of at least 75%. The invention relates to the method for the preparation of a porous galenic form by means of the said matrix.
